Choosing the right operating system is crucial for digital sketching, especially when working with a budget of under $1500. The OS you select can influence the software compatibility, hardware options, and overall user experience. In this article, we explore the best operating systems suited for digital artists and illustrators within this budget range.
Key Factors When Choosing an OS for Digital Sketching
- Software Compatibility: Ensure the OS supports popular drawing applications like Adobe Photoshop, Corel Painter, or Krita.
- Hardware Options: Consider the availability of compatible tablets, styluses, and computers.
- User Interface: A user-friendly interface can enhance productivity and comfort during long creative sessions.
- Performance: The OS should efficiently handle high-resolution files and multitasking.
- Cost: The total cost of hardware and software should stay within the $1500 budget.
Top Operating Systems for Digital Sketching
Windows 10/11
Windows remains a popular choice for digital artists due to its broad software compatibility and hardware options. Many affordable laptops and tablets run Windows, providing flexibility within a $1500 budget. Artists can access a wide range of creative software, and the OS supports various pen-input devices, making it ideal for digital sketching.
macOS (MacBook Air or MacBook Pro)
Apple’s macOS offers a sleek user interface and excellent build quality. While MacBooks tend to be pricier, some refurbished or entry-level models can fit within the budget. macOS supports industry-standard creative software, and the hardware’s reliability benefits artists who prioritize stability and performance.
Chrome OS
For artists on a tight budget, Chromebooks running Chrome OS can be a viable option. Many models are affordable and support Android apps, including some drawing applications. However, hardware options are more limited, and software choices are fewer compared to Windows or macOS. Suitable for beginners or those who prefer cloud-based workflows.
Additional Considerations
Beyond the OS, investing in a good drawing tablet or 2-in-1 device can significantly enhance your digital sketching experience. Compatibility with stylus pressure sensitivity and tilt features should be verified. Additionally, consider the availability of tutorials and community support for your chosen platform.
Conclusion
Within a $1500 budget, Windows offers the most versatility and software options for digital sketching, making it an excellent choice for most artists. MacOS provides a seamless experience with high-quality hardware, though it may require careful shopping or refurbished models. Chrome OS can be suitable for beginners or casual artists. Ultimately, your choice should align with your specific needs, preferred software, and hardware preferences.
